When To Act

When sampling makes sense in Anaheim.

Anaheim’s housing stock runs older than most of the county, and that shows up in the plumbing before it shows up anywhere else. West Anaheim’s tract homes went up fast during the Disneyland-era building boom, and the cast-iron and galvanized pipe running through those walls is well past the age where slow, unnoticed leaks start. Two-story homes in Anaheim Hills add a different version of the same problem: an upstairs bathroom leak travels through the floor and turns into a ceiling stain in the room below, and by the time anyone notices the discoloration, growth has usually had weeks to establish itself.

The reasons people actually pick up the phone vary. A doctor wants documentation before treating symptoms nobody can otherwise explain. An escrow stalls because a buyer wants proof of what’s behind the drywall before closing. A landlord needs a report that holds up in a dispute, instead of two people arguing opinions at each other. A property manager near the resort district needs to know, quickly and quietly, whether a guest’s complaint about a musty room is founded. None of these get easier by waiting, and a lab result is the only thing that actually settles them.

The Process

How mold sampling works.

Every visit starts with a control sample, not a testing method. We pull an outdoor air sample the same day as anything collected inside, because an indoor spore count means nothing on its own. It only becomes useful once it’s compared against what’s already drifting around outside your front door that day. From there, air sampling draws a measured volume of air through a cassette bound for an accredited outside lab, which returns spore counts and species identification. Surface sampling, using swabs, tape lifts, or small material samples, covers anywhere you can see growth or suspect it, and it’s how a specific species like Stachybotrys gets confirmed or ruled out.

Everything collected is logged under chain of custody before it leaves the property. Lab turnaround typically runs three to five business days, and the report you get is the same one we get: not a version edited to steer you toward a sale.

Pricing

Mold sampling cost in Anaheim, CA.

One room with a single air sample and an outdoor control sits at the inexpensive end. A full property assessment, covering crawl space, attic, and any suspect walls, costs more simply because there’s more area and material to test. That’s really the only variable: how many samples the job needs, and how much of the house you want looked at. Lab fees are broken out as their own line on the quote, so you can see what’s going to the lab and what’s going to us, and you’ll have that quote in writing before we collect a single sample. The number on the quote is the number on the invoice.
